Transaction 731e5a18ce03b974640ad6bede597436b85c99afb6909161ec3556a78980605f
1 Input
1 Output
-
731e5a18ce03b974640ad6bede597436b85c99afb6909161ec3556a78980605f:0
- value
- 9642564
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f9d98bba24418197e87ca7e6316ea49036d6c26
- address
- bc1q97we3wazgsvpjl58eflxx9h2fypk6mpxj9jf2r